Durant’s Frustration in Phoenix: Bradley Beal’s Injuries and Weak Role Players

This is reported by Adrian Wojnarowski from ESPN. “If you talk to the people in Phoenix, you know they can feel Durant’s frustration,” Wojnarowski said on NBA Countdown on the sidelines of the Christmas Games. Woj cited Bradley Beal’s injuries and the weak role players as reasons.

“They don’t have any assists or draft picks to improve the team,” the ESPN man continued. “They have to manage that now. Durant knows this from Brooklyn and knows how small a title window can be. This team has to win and, the way it is put together, very quickly. (…) There is a lot at stake for the Suns at the moment .”

Beal has only played six games this season and was hardly able to impress. The shooting guard is currently out again and is not expected back until January. In his six games, Beal averaged just 14.7 points, 3.3 rebounds and 3.2 assists. His points average is as low as it was in his rookie season in 2012/13.
